Dr. William F. Jackson is a leading orthopedic surgeon and researcher whose work centers on advancing total knee arthroplasty (TKA) through precision and patient-specific alignment. His primary research areas include robotic-assisted surgical techniques, kinematic alignment, and the application of anatomical landmarks to improve surgical reproducibility. Dr. Jackson’s most influential contribution is his 2019 cadaveric study on the accuracy of a new robotically assisted TKA technique, which has garnered 158 citations and established a benchmark for evaluating robotic systems in knee replacement. More recently, he has focused on restricted kinematic alignment, demonstrating how the lateral malleolus can serve as a simple, reliable landmark for performing safe, alignment-restricted TKA in Japanese populations. This work addresses a critical gap in adapting global alignment principles to diverse anatomies. Dr. Jackson’s research is notable for bridging engineering precision with clinical practicality, offering surgeons accessible tools to enhance outcomes. His studies are widely cited in orthopedic literature and have influenced both surgical training and the design of next-generation robotic platforms.
